Though nothing has been formally announced just yet, fans are widely under the assumption that Uzi's next project is titled Eternal Atake. Last month, Uzi shared what certainly looked like cover art for something that certainly looked like an album. The art, in controversial fashion, borrowed heavily from imagery associated with the Heaven's Gate cult. Surviving members of the cult later expressed their disapproval, telling Genius they feel the Eternal Atake art was a "direct and clear infringement." The art has since been removed from Uzi's official social channels.
